Released in 1940, Green Hell enters the Adventure genre with a narrative focused on A group of adventurers head deep into South American jungle in search of an ancient Incan treasure. Under the direction of James Whale, the film attempts to weave detailed character arcs with visual storytelling.
The film is anchored by performances from Douglas Fairbanks Jr., Joan Bennett, John Howard. While the cast delivers competent performances, the script occasionally limits their range.
